I recently received an old italian stilleto from my father perhaps purchased in mexico or california 30+ years ago. It is in pretty rough shape and i was hoping to get it back to working condition. The lever release isn't grabbing the blade, looks like it's missing a spring. anyone know of any replacement parts or a way to rig something, perhaps modify the underside of the handle scale to allow for this rigging to fit properly.

You knife is actually worth a professional restoration.
Any amateur repair will hurt the value. Don't "rig" anything!
You have already improperly removed the handle. Let a professional repair the knife.
 
It's hard to tell from your pictures, but it looks like the button spring leaf slips under the "ears" of the button pivot.
Others use a leaf spring that is riveted to the liner. You might try a coil spring under the button if you can't make a leaf spring.
